  <dc:title>Letter from W [William] Ramsay, 19 Chester Terrace, Regent's Park, to [Joseph] Larmor</dc:title>
  <dc:description>He has written to Steele explaining Larmor's difficulties in understanding his paper. His reply is enclosed [not present] with a letter from Walker, and Larmor's own letter. He is sure that Steele is 'all right in substance'. </dc:description>
  <dc:date>19 December 1904</dc:date>
